The makers of Ravi Teja’s upcoming action film, “Tiger Nageswara Rao,” initially set October 20 as the release date and planned their post-production accordingly. However, a recent development with the postponement of “Salaar” from September 28 has left that long weekend open for a potential release.
Distributors suggest that Tiger Nageswara Rao could benefit from releasing on September 28, as it will benefit from a long weekend.
However, there’s a challenge since substantial post-production work is still pending, and there’s no guarantee it can be completed by that date. The team is currently evaluating all factors and planning an official release date announcement, but the uncertainty is causing confusion.
The makers are trying their best to release the film on September 28/29, but they also don’t want to compromise on the quality of the film.
Tiger Nageswara Rao is looking to be one of the most promising films from Ravi Teja in a long time. Be it the budget, scale, making, and technical department, this film is cut above all the films that Ravi Teja has done in the past few years.
Tiger Nageswara Rao, releasing on September 28, would be the best thing to happen for it because of the lucrative date. It would be a great loss to lose such a perfect date, but the makers also cannot compromise on the quality of the film.
If the VFX/CG work turns out to be a hurried job, it might affect its box office prospects in a big way. Also, if they decide to come during September end, there will not be much time for promotion, which also might spell harm for the film.
Ravi Teja’s Tiger Nageswara Rao is in a tight spot now. Today, there’s going to be a crucial meeting among the makers of the film, and a final decision will be taken.
